In vitro cytotoxicity and antibiotic activity of polymyxin B nonapeptide.

A K Duwe, C A Rupar, G B Horsman, S I Vas.   

Abstract

Polymyxin B nonapeptide, prepared by enzymic removal of the fatty acyl diaminobutyric acid side chain from polymyxin B, was about 100-fold less toxic to K562 cells than polymyxin B. MICs of polymyxin B nonapeptide against a test panel of bacteria were 2- to 64-fold lower than those of polymyxin B.
